#ifndef QTSPARKLE_UPDATER_H
#define QTSPARKLE_UPDATER_H

#include <QObject>
#include <QScopedPointer>

class QIcon;
class QNetworkAccessManager;
class QUrl;

namespace qtsparkle {

// Loads qtsparkle's translations from the .ts files compiled into the library,
// and installs them using QCoreApplication::installTranslator.  Use this
// function if you want to use a non-default language for qtsparkle.  If you
// do not call this function, it will be called with the default language
// (QLocale::system().name()) the first time qtsparkle::Updater is created.
void LoadTranslations(const QString& language);


// The Updater is the main class in qtsparkle that you should use in your
// application.  Updater loads its settings from QSettings in its constructor,
// so it's important you set an organizationName, organizationDomain and
// applicationName in QCoreApplication before calling it.
// On the second run of this application it will create a dialog asking the
// user for permission to check for updates.  After that, if the user gave
// permission, it will check for updates automatically on startup.
// Checking for updates and displaying dialogs is done after the application
// returns to the event loop, not in the constructor.
class Updater : public QObject {
  Q_OBJECT

public:
  // appcast_url is the URL that this class should use when checking for
  // updates.  If parent is not NULL then any dialogs created by this class
  // are parented to that widget.
  Updater(const QUrl& appcast_url, QWidget* parent);
  ~Updater();

  // Sets a network access manager to use when making network requests.  If
  // network is NULL, or if this function is not called, this class will create
  // a new QNetworkManager.
  // Must be called before the application returns to the event loop after this
  // object is created.
  // The Updater will NOT take ownership of the network manager, and you must
  // ensure it is not deleted while the Updater is still in scope.
  void SetNetworkAccessManager(QNetworkAccessManager* network);

  // Sets an icon to use in any dialogs that are created.  If no icon is set,
  // the windowIcon() of the parent widget passed to the constructor is used
  // instead.  The icon should be 64x64 pixels or greater.
  void SetIcon(const QIcon& icon);

  // Sets the current version.  If this is not called then the default is to
  // use QCoreApplication::applicationVersion()
  void SetVersion(const QString& version);

  // Sets the update check interval in msec. Default value is one day (86400000).
  // Minimum value is one hour (3600000)
  void SetUpdateInterval(int msec);

public slots:
  // Checks for updates now.  You probably want to call this from a menu item
  // in your application's main window.
  void CheckNow();

private slots:
  void AutoCheck();

protected:
  bool event(QEvent* e);

private:
  struct Private;
  QScopedPointer<Private> d;
};

} // namespace qtsparkle


#endif // QTSPARKLE_UPDATER_H
